Title: rhythmbox itself prevents iPod from ejecting Status in Rhythmbox: Expired Status in rhythmbox package in Ubuntu: Triaged Bug description: Binary package hint: rhythmbox Its a rather silly issue. When I try to unmount my iPod via rhythmbox, it tells me that the iPod is being used. A quick 'lsof' revealed the following: ---------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------- utkarsh@utkarsh-laptop:/media$ lsof | grep MUSICALLY_U rhythmbox 6104 utkarsh 22r REG 8,16 3499915 30048 /media/MUSICALLY_U/iPod_Control/Music/F69/04 Scar Tissue.m4a (deleted) ------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------ Apparently it was rhythmbox itself which was holding on to a file on the iPod which I had deleted; after playing another file from my local music collection, I was able to unmount the iPod easily.
